Fundamentals Of Retail Design
The most important function of a retail space is to assist the buyers in buying the exhibited goods without difficulty and to enable the retailer to attract buyers to the products for effective selling. This is the reason why the design of retail areas and stores, that is the retail design, is comprised of features of graphic design, ergonomics and promotion, along with the typical features of interior designing and architecture.
While designing a retail space, it is crucial that the specific needs of that particular retail space are taken into consideration. For instance, the design needs for a supermarket would differ radically from those for an art emporium. Designing requires giving attention to numerous factors, for instance, the number and kind of products which will be on display, the level of participation by the shop staff in selling process and various other such aspects. Certain retail spaces only need to show some samples of merchandise, on the other hand, others allow trial of the items by the buyers prior to sale. Depending on such requirements, the retail design will have to be different.
Along with the practical details of a retail design, the appeal of the retail area from the point of view of the customers must also be considered. It is important that customers feel welcome in the shop once they enter, and are prompted to make purchases before leaving. The designing of the retail space can greatly contribute in this respect. There should also be place within the store for promoting the products through promotions to increase the probability of a sale.
Moreover, the retail store must impress the buyers to such an extent that they are compelled to visit the store again for more shopping. Thus, an expert retail designer will always give due attention to the environment of the shop that would guarantee that the customers have a good and pleasant time in the shop.
To develop a good retail design, it is important to have a fair understanding of marketing basics, space planning and some idea of buyers’ psychology, among other things. These factors should be understood both by the owner of the retail space, so that the precise needs can be communicated in an efficient manner, and by the retail designers, so that the design effectively fulfils those requirements.
Finally, it is not only the designing of interiors of the store that requires special attention. The exteriors of the store are equally important and should be striking so that the buyers are tempted to come in and check out the goods.
